Prabhudas Lilladher's research report on DOMS Industries
DOMS IN reported better-than-expected performance with revenues of Rs5,679mn (PLe Rs5,500mn) and EBITDA margin of 17.5% (PLe 17.3%) aided by healthy volume growth in stationary segment amid new product launches within categories like scholastic stationery, kits & combos and office supplies. Even hygiene business reported healthy revenues of Rs474mn (PLe Rs400mn) with an EBITDA margin of 8.1% (PLe 7.5%). The new development plan on 44- acres land parcel at Umbergaon has witnessed slight delay due to extensive monsoons (Rs1,500mn incurred towards capex in 1HFY26) and commercial production is expected to begin by 1QFY27E. Aided by capacity expansion in core stationery business, widening product basket (SKU count is up by ~300 in last 1 year), and strengthening distribution network (retail touch points are up by ~10K in last 1 year) we expect sales/PAT CAGR of 22%/24% over FY25- FY28E.
Outlook
We broadly maintain our estimates and maintain BUY on the stock with a TP of Rs3,085 (60x FY27E EPS; no change in target multiple).
